TC LogiQ says that the checks can take up to two weeks. One example they gave me of a possible delay would be if their search found someone with your name who had lived in the same area where you were from, and who had been convicted of a crime in the past. They will do some extra checking to be certain that they are looking at two different people before completing their processing. Additional steps like this slow down the process, even though you are squeaky clean!

Based on anecdotal reports that I've received thus far, you might get your response as early as 15 minutes after submission, or as late at 10-14 days. I would strongly recommend completing the background check well in advance of when you'll need your card, just in case yours is one of the checks that takes longer to complete.
